Application

This unit of competency describes the skills and knowledge required to research, extract and provide information on issues and policies.

This unit applies to individuals who take responsibility for their own work and for the quality of the work of others within known parameters. They provide and communicate solutions to a range of predictable and sometimes unpredictable problems.

No occupational licensing, legislative or certification requirements are known to apply to this unit at the time of publication.

Elements and Performance Criteria

Element

Performance criteria

Elements describe the essential outcomes.

Performance criteria describe the performance needed to demonstrate achievement of the element.

1. Process a request for information on issues and policies

1.1 Document the request using the appropriate recording system

1.2 Record relevant notes from dialogue with the client and from correspondence

1.3 Seek and obtain approval to access information and forward requests where appropriate

1.4 Listen actively to the client and question appropriately to clarify and elicit information

1.5 Follow enterprise work health and safety policies

2. Identify sources and extract information

2.1 Identify, access and research relevant sources and locations of information

2.2 Provide clear sequenced verbal instructions to colleagues who require assistance

2.3 Evaluate workplace policies and documentation relevant to the request

2.4 Locate and extract information relevant to the particular request

2.5 Use alternative methods to locate identified gaps in information

3. Evaluate information for meeting client request

3.1 Evaluate information for its validity and reliability and appropriateness to the client request

3.2 Engage client in effective dialogue to clarify indistinct or incorrect information

3.3 Obtain additional information if available information is inadequate, unclear, conflicting or incorrect

4. Prepare and finalise report

4.1 Develop, write, format and proof read report

4.2 Check report for accuracy and intention

4.3 Arrange report’s review and sign off with designated person where required

4.4 Make a record of report and correspondence

4.5 Forward report and correspondence to client

Performance Evidence

The candidate must be assessed on their ability to integrate and apply the performance requirements of this unit in a workplace setting. Performance must be demonstrated consistently over time and in a suitable range of contexts.

The candidate must provide evidence that they can:

  • process a request for information
  • access information to respond to a request
  • collate information to deal specifically with the request
  • prepare a response using chosen media
  • maintain a record of the information provided and file for future reference
  • use industry standard terminology.

Knowledge Evidence

The candidate must demonstrate knowledge of:

  • workplace policies and documentation on local, regional, state and national issues
  • relevant workplace documentation on international treaties, agreements and charters
  • types of information sources
  • methods and means of accessing and extracting the required information
  • methods of validating information
  • types of reports and their uses.
